package com.android.launcher3;
import android.view.animation.AccelerateInterpolator;
import android.view.animation.AnimationUtils;
import android.view.animation.Interpolator;
/**
* Scroller that gradually reaches a target velocity.
*/
class RampUpScroller {
private final Interpolator mInterpolator;
private final long mRampUpTime;
private long mStartTime;
private long mDeltaTime;
private float mTargetVelocityX;
private float mTargetVelocityY;
private int mDeltaX;
private int mDeltaY;
/**
* Creates a new ramp-up scroller that reaches full velocity after a
* specified duration.
*
* @param rampUpTime Duration before the scroller reaches target velocity.
*/
public RampUpScroller(long rampUpTime) {
mInterpolator = new AccelerateInterpolator();
mRampUpTime = rampUpTime;
}
/**
* Starts the scroller at the current animation time.
*/
public void start() {
mStartTime = AnimationUtils.currentAnimationTimeMillis();
mDeltaTime = mStartTime;
}
/**
* Computes the current scroll deltas. This usually only be called after
* starting the scroller with {@link #start()}.
*
* @see #getDeltaX()
* @see #getDeltaY()
*/
public void computeScrollDelta() {
final long currentTime = AnimationUtils.currentAnimationTimeMillis();
final long elapsedSinceStart = currentTime - mStartTime;
final float scale;
if (elapsedSinceStart < mRampUpTime) {
scale = mInterpolator.getInterpolation((float) elapsedSinceStart / mRampUpTime);
} else {
scale = 1f;
}
final long elapsedSinceDelta = currentTime - mDeltaTime;
mDeltaTime = currentTime;
mDeltaX = (int) (elapsedSinceDelta * scale * mTargetVelocityX);
mDeltaY = (int) (elapsedSinceDelta * scale * mTargetVelocityY);
}
/**
* Sets the target velocity for this scroller.
*
* @param x The target X velocity in pixels per millisecond.
* @param y The target Y velocity in pixels per millisecond.
*/
public void setTargetVelocity(float x, float y) {
mTargetVelocityX = x;
mTargetVelocityY = y;
}
/**
* @return The target X velocity for this scroller.
*/
public float getTargetVelocityX() {
return mTargetVelocityX;
}
/**
* @return The target Y velocity for this scroller.
*/
public float getTargetVelocityY() {
return mTargetVelocityY;
}
/**
* The distance traveled in the X-coordinate computed by the last call to
* {@link #computeScrollDelta()}.
*/
public int getDeltaX() {
return mDeltaX;
}
/**
* The distance traveled in the Y-coordinate computed by the last call to
* {@link #computeScrollDelta()}.
*/
public int getDeltaY() {
return mDeltaY;
}
}
